Q: Is 65,412,184 a Composite Number?

 A: Yes, 65,412,184 is a composite number.

Why is 65,412,184 a composite number?

A composite number is a number that can be divided evenly by more numbers than 1 and itself. It is the opposite of a prime number.

The number 65,412,184 can be evenly divided by 1 2 4 8 23 46 92 184 355,501 711,002 1,422,004 2,844,008 8,176,523 16,353,046 32,706,092 and 65,412,184, with no remainder.

Since 65,412,184 cannot be divided by just 1 and 65,412,184, it is a composite number.
